Online platforms and resources dedicated to connecting job seekers with available positions in Lodi, California, offer a centralized hub for local opportunities. These resources typically categorize jobs by industry, experience level, and employment type (full-time, part-time, contract). An example would be a website specializing in agricultural jobs in the Lodi area, filtering results by keywords like “vineyard” or “winery.”
Access to such localized job boards offers significant advantages for both job seekers and employers. For individuals seeking employment, these platforms provide a streamlined approach to finding relevant openings within their desired geographic area, eliminating the need to sift through broader, less targeted listings. For businesses, they offer a cost-effective way to reach a pool of local talent, potentially reducing recruitment expenses and time-to-hire. Historically, local newspapers and community centers played this connecting role; however, the digital age has shifted this function primarily online, increasing accessibility and reach.
